How much does it cost to rent a home in Honolulu County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Honolulu County 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,386 | $1,195 | $10,000+ |
| Honolulu County 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,393 | $1,750 | $10,000+ |
| Honolulu County 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,343 | $2,400 | $10,000+ |
| Honolulu County 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,531 | $3,850 | $10,000+ |
| Honolulu County 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,900 | $1,350 | $8,500 |
| Honolulu County 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$17,318 | $9,637 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Honolulu County
What type of rentals are currently available in Honolulu County?
There are currently 3952 Apartments for Rent in Honolulu County, HI with pricing that ranges from $900 to $21,261. There are also 839 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Honolulu County ranging from $850 to $45,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Honolulu County?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Honolulu County ranges from $850 to $45,000 with an average monthly rent of $6,780.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Honolulu County?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Honolulu County range from $1,095 to $9,799,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,750 to $25,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,400 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,545.
